During the last weeks of the 1998-99 school year, Master Peace will create collaborative art projects with students in four Miami-Dade County elementary schools. Students will be working with Miami artist Xavier Cortada and using Internet technology in the development of these collaborative murals for their schools.
Each school will have a discussion forum and student web gallery capturing the words and images that contributed to the murals' creation. Please click on the hyperlinks below to access each school's project webpage:

Master Peace is a collaborative effort of Miami-Dade Art in Public Places, Miami-Dade County Public Schools, Division of Life Skills, and Regis House, Inc., a non-profit community-based center helping children and families. Miami artist Xavier Cortada is Master Peace's founder and serves as its Artistic Director.
